Effect of microserum environment stimulation on extraction and biological function of colorectal cancer stem cells
Abstract Background 3D cancer stem cell (CSC) cultures are widely used as in vitro tumor models. In this study, we determined the effects of enriching HCT116 tumor spheres initially cultured in serum-free medium with different concentrations of serum, focusing on the effect of microserum environment...
